I ordered mine here and used three bags to cover this whole tree. You pretty much just thread some twine onto a long needle and feed the felt balls through it. This really doesn’t require any tutorial. The yarn one is a great one to make while listening to a book on tape, podcast or even watching a movie.įirst up is the felt one. That being said the felt one can be done in about ten to fifteen minutes and doesn’t make a mess whereas the yarn one takes hours and hours and your whole work area is covered in “fuzzies” when you are done. The felt garland is not as budget friendly as the yarn one. (I am also making more of the felt one to use on the tree in our bedroom).
